Summary
  1. Michael Smuin discusses the San Francisco Ballet and their participation in the Ballet America series at Brooklyn Academy of Music, Oct. 14-19, 1980; Richard LeBlond's work fundraising for the company; he identifies the choreographers for their performances at BAM, including: Lew Christensen, John McFall, William Christensen, Tomm Ruud, Robert Gladstein and himself.
